Why Choose Plane from Toronto to Banff
Traveling from Toronto to Banff offers a plethora of stunning landscapes and experiences. Choosing the right mode of transportation is crucial to maximizing your journey and ensuring a smooth arrival.
💰 Quick Travel Time
pros
- The direct flight from Toronto to Calgary takes only 4 hours and 8 minutes, making it the fastest option available.
- By choosing to fly, travelers save significant travel time compared to lengthy bus or train journeys.
cons
- Flying involves time spent at the airport for check-in and security, which could add to the total travel duration.
🛎️ Access to Calgary International Airport
pros
- Calgary International Airport is located only about 90 minutes from Banff, allowing for convenient transportation to the national park.
- Upon arrival, multiple shuttle services and rental car options are available to quickly reach your destination.
cons
- Unlike buses or trains that might have stops closer to Banff, you may need additional transport from Calgary Airport to reach your final destination in Banff.
⭐ Airline Amenities and Comfort
pros
- Airlines like WestJet and Air Canada offer amenities such as in-flight entertainment and complimentary snacks, enhancing the travel experience.
- Luggage allowances and the option to upgrade can make the journey more comfortable compared to buses or trains.
cons
- In-flight services can vary depending on the airline, potentially leading to variations in comfort and convenience.
highlights:
Travelers should account for additional time needed for airport procedures when comparing flight times to buses or trains.
Flight travel significantly reduces time spent on the journey from Toronto to Banff.
The proximity of Calgary International Airport to Banff enables efficient transfers by shuttle or rental car.
Airlines provide a variety of amenities that enhance passenger comfort and convenience.

Travel Tips
⛰ Pack Smart for Changing Weather
Banff can experience a range of weather conditions, from sunny to snowy, even in summer. Bring layers and a lightweight jacket to stay comfortable during your flight and upon arrival.
📍 Get Ahead of the Altitude
Banff is located at a high altitude (over 4,500 feet). To help acclimate, stay hydrated during your flight and avoid excessive alcohol consumption prior to arrival.
